What you’ll be doing
• Will create, own, drive and support architecture for the Eagle-i platform and business area, including new architecture design needed to bring Eagle-i automation into SMB.
• Owns and maintains a futures candidate roadmap for the Futures team including Eagle-i, BT’s strategic automation, detection and response platform. The objective is for business stakeholders to build portfolio roadmap from this output.
• Defines and leads new strategic process to co-create, design and build new services between BT and Customer. This speeds up C2M process.
• Responsible for answering the most complex questions regarding technology capabilities and requirements and shapes consultation on complex customer and product projects.
• Will scout ahead on change in the industry, BT incubation and BT applied research and communicate architectural assessment and insight to help set Security Portfolio future strategy, and decide which futures activities require rapid impact analysis activities and will identify the right stakeholders in Futures team to run these assessments.
• Drives the identification of major data risks, as well as risk resolution and mitigation when bringing new innovation to life e.g. use of AI.
Experience required
• Depth of cyber security experience, ideally with operational / delivery / forensics / etc. experience.
• Developing long term roadmaps linked to business outcomes.
• Enterprise Architecture Frameworks and their relevance to the practice of Enterprise Architecture.
• Can demonstrate technical abilities, balanced with a commercial flair, to understand what future investments are in BT’s holistic interests
• Able to navigate large, complex organisations.
• Demonstrable experience of CISSP, CISSM or similar.
• Engaging with customers and supporting bids up to the C suite, in particular CISO, CIO, CTO.
